Reproductive Age
The period in an organism's life during which it is biologically capable of producing offspring.
Offspring
The biological children or young produced by a pair or a group of parents.
Deleterious Allele
A version of a gene that, due to mutation, can result in a lower chance of survival or reproduction for an organism that carries it.
Mutation-Selection Balance
An equilibrium state between the introduction of new genetic mutations and the removal of maladaptive ones by natural selection.
